It is one the oldest and steals strong program to establish a Secure Shell (SSH) connection over the unsecured network. The OpenSSH in Windows 10 allows you to directly connect to remote servers using command prompt or PowerShell without the need of any third party software.Īs it is still in beta stage, so be sure that you are using it for testing purpose in a secure network.b As per one GitHub report the OpenSSH in Windows 10 still has bugs so if you need something for production you can use the PuTTY. One of such features is a native support to OpenSSH client and server in the Windows 10 Fall creators update. The Windows 10 OpenSSH client and server features are still in beta stage. The Microsoft has enabled lots of good options for developers to ease their work by featuring the Developer option in the Windows 10.
